四、新冠病毒核酸阳性捐献者器官捐献的建议:
(一)肝脏、肾脏、心脏等非肺脏器官捐献
1. 捐献者14天内有新冠病毒感染史,鼻咽拭子核酸或抗原检测阴性,按照按公民逝世后器官捐献流程正常实施捐献。
2. 捐献者感染新冠病毒,鼻咽拭子新冠病毒抗原或核酸检测阳性,无相关临床病史,按照按公民逝世后器官捐献流程正常实施捐献。
3. 捐献者感染新冠病毒,鼻咽拭子新冠病毒抗原或核酸检测阳性,临床分型为轻型和中型,按照公民逝世后器官捐献流程正常实施捐献。
4. 捐献者感染新冠病毒,鼻咽拭子新冠病毒抗原或核酸检测阳性,临床分型为重型,核酸检测低病毒载量(Ct值≥30),可按照按公民逝世后器官捐献流程实施捐献。
5. 捐献者感染新冠病毒,鼻咽拭子新冠病毒抗原或核酸检测阳性,临床分型为重型,核酸检测高病毒载量(Ct值<30),移植等待者紧急情况下可实施器官捐献;或经抗病毒治疗新冠病毒核酸检测低病毒载量(Ct值≥30)或转阴,可按照按公民逝世后器官捐献流程实施捐献。
6. 捐献者感染新冠病毒,鼻咽拭子新冠病毒核酸或抗原检测阳性,临床分型为危重型,核酸检测高病毒载量(Ct<30),不建议捐献器官;鼻咽拭子新冠病毒核酸检测低病毒载量(Ct≥30),移植等待者紧急情况下可实施器官捐献。

(二)肺脏捐献
1. 捐献者14天内有新冠病毒感染史,鼻咽拭子、肺泡灌洗液核酸或抗原检测阴性,肺部影像学无明显病变,按照按公民逝世后器官捐献流程实施肺脏捐献。
2. 捐献者感染新冠病毒,鼻咽拭子新冠病毒核酸或抗原检测阳性,临床分型为轻型,移植等待者紧急情况下可严格标准实施肺脏捐献。
3. 捐献者感染新冠病毒,鼻咽拭子新冠病毒核酸或抗原检测阳性,临床分型为中型或重症,不适合肺脏捐献。
